预览加载中,请您耐心等待几秒...
1/4
2/4
3/4
4/4

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

基于改进集束搜索的立体车库库位布局优化研究 摘要 本文基于改进的集束搜索算法,对车库库位布局进行了优化研究。首先,本文介绍了立体车库的特点以及现有研究成果;其次,对集束搜索算法进行了详细的描述,并提出了改进算法;最后,通过实验验证了改进集束搜索算法的优越性。实验结果表明,改进算法可以显著提高车库库位的利用率和效率。 关键词:立体车库;库位布局;集束搜索;优化 Abstract Thispaperisbasedontheimprovedbundlesearchalgorithmtooptimizethelayoutofcarparkingspacesinthegarage.Firstofall,thispaperintroducesthecharacteristicsofthestereogarageandexistingresearchresults,andthendescribesthebundlesearchalgorithmindetailandproposesanimprovedalgorithm.Finally,thesuperiorperformanceoftheimprovedbundlesearchalgorithmisverifiedthroughexperiments.Theexperimentalresultsshowthattheimprovedalgorithmcansignificantlyimprovetheutilizationandefficiencyofcarparkingspacesinthegarage. Keywords:stereogarage;parkingspacelayout;bundlesearch;optimization 1.引言 随着汽车数量的不断增加和城市化进程的不断加快,停车难题愈发突出。为了解决这一问题,人们开始采用立体车库的形式进行停车。立体车库可以大大提高车位的利用率,但是要实现高效的停车,需要合理布局车位。因此,如何优化立体车库的库位布局是一个重要的研究方向。 目前,关于立体车库的库位布局研究已有一些成果。传统的方法主要利用经验和直觉进行布局,这种方法容易受到人为因素的影响,限制了布局的优化程度。近年来,研究者们开始采用优化算法进行立体车库的库位布局优化。其中,遗传算法、模拟退火算法、蚁群算法等经典优化算法都有应用。但是,这些算法需要大量的计算时间和空间,限制了其实际应用效果。 为了解决以上问题,本文采用改进的集束搜索算法来进行立体车库的库位布局优化。集束搜索算法是一种比传统优化算法更为高效的算法,本文改进了其适应度函数,以此提高其优化效果。实验结果表明,本文提出的改进算法可以显著提高车库库位的利用率和效率。 2.立体车库库位布局优化方法 2.1立体车库的特点 立体车库是一种以楼层为单位的多层车库,具有垂直复式储车车位、转盘式储车车位、平面式储车车位等形式,可以利用建筑空间垂直方向的更多空间,提高车位的利用率。 立体车库的优点是明显的,但同时也存在如下问题: (1)车位的布局困难:不同类型的车位需要根据设计要求和使用需求进行合理布局,这个问题比平面停车场还要更加复杂。 (2)容易出现滞留:立体车库存在转盘车库等复杂结构,如果不合理布局,会特别容易出现滞留现象。 (3)使用维护难度高:立体车库存在的特殊结构和使用方式,要求使用者有一定领域知识和操作技巧,增加了使用和维护的难度。 2.2集束搜索算法 集束搜索算法是一种全局优化算法,属于一种启发式搜索算法。其基本思想是利用一定数量的束来探索解空间,在探索空间时通过引入一定的随机性来实现全局搜索。集束搜索算法速度较快,特别适用于初值很难求得的优化问题。 集束搜索算法的步骤如下: (1)初始化种群。 (2)评估适应度值。 (3)选出当前最佳解。 (4)更新束中的解。 (5)重复以上步骤。 2.3算法改进 本文通过改进适应度函数来提高集束搜索算法的性能。具体地,本文采用数理统计方法来对立体车库进行特征提取,然后根据特征提取结果计算适应度值,以此指导算法的搜索方向。改进后的算法流程如下: (1)初始化一个数量为N的随机解种群S。 (2)利用数理统计方法对立体车库的每个车位进行特征提取,得到特征向量。 (3)计算每个解的适应度值,该适应度值是基于特征向量之间的相似度计算得到的。 (4)选取适应度值最好的k个解,作为束,用集束搜索算法进行优化,更新解。 (5)将k个最优解中不重复的解,加入全局解种群Sg,直到满足停止条件。 3.实验结果分析 为了测试改进算法的效果,本文在两个不同规模的立体车库进行实验。实验结果表明,改进算法可以显著提高车库库位的利用率和效率。 实验1:一栋20层的立体车库,包括320个车位。 在这个实验中,